The EIC Transition programme from the European Innovation Council (EIC) is a funding initiative within Horizon Europe to support the growth and validation of innovative technologies furthermore to the trial phase at the labs. Its objective is to facilitate the technological advances transition towards its application in the market through development and commercialization strategies.
The main objective of the EIC Transition is to help transform technological discoveries into commercial impact innovations. It funds technological validation activities on relevant areas and the business model development for its introduction in the market.
The EIC Transition does not have thematic preset priorities, and it is open to proposals on any field of the science, technology or its “application”. The programme provides funding with the total indicative budget of 2,5 million of euros per project, covering the 100% of the eligible costs. Moreover, there are additional subventions up to 50.000 euros for complementary activities focused on searching for commercialization routes or enhance synergies withing the EIC projects wallet. Individual applicants (SMEs, spin-offs, start-ups, research organisations, universities) or small consortia with a maximum of five partners can apply.
The majority of funding will be awarded through open calls without pre-defined thematic priorities.
This open funding is designed to enable the support of any technology and innovation that cuts across different scientific, technological, sectoral and application fields or represents novel combinations.
The maximum grant will be €2.5 million.
